Q: Is 11,015,288 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,015,288 is a composite number.

Why is 11,015,288 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,015,288 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 19 38 76 152 72,469 144,938 289,876 579,752 1,376,911 2,753,822 5,507,644 and 11,015,288, with no remainder.

Since 11,015,288 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,015,288, it is a composite number.
